Jim Diodati is encouraging everyone to think twice before they post anything on social media.
The Mayor of Niagara Falls has posted another video on his Twitter page to explain the details of his new Social Media Neutral Zone.
He says its a place where people can exchange their thoughts and opinions online in a kind and positive manner.
He adds the goal is to lift people up, not tear them down.
Diodati says he couldn't find a Social Media Neutral Zone online so he's going to create one, starting with his own Twitter, Facebook, Instagram and LinkedIn accounts.
He says anyone who chooses to be disrespectful will be deleted or blocked.
